Blue Hibiscus and Purpleleaf Shiso Physical Information

Blue Hibiscus and Purpleleaf Shiso physical information is very important for comparison. Blue Hibiscus height is 120.00 cm and width 120.00 cm whereas Purpleleaf Shiso height is 60.00 cm and width 25.40 cm. The color specification of Blue Hibiscus and Purpleleaf Shiso are as follows:

  • Blue Hibiscus flower color: Blue, Purple and Blue Violet

  • Blue Hibiscus leaf color: Dark Green

  • Purpleleaf Shiso flower color: White

  • Purpleleaf Shiso leaf color: Purple and Burgundy
